Understanding Microwave Overheating
Microwave overheating occurs when the appliance’s internal temperature exceeds its safe operating range. This can happen due to a range of factors, including faulty magnetrons, malfunctioning thermostats, and blockages in the ventilation system. When a microwave overheats, it can lead to a range of problems, from burning smells to actual fires. It’s essential to take microwave overheating seriously and take steps to prevent it.
To understand microwave overheating, it’s helpful to know how microwaves work. Microwaves use non-ionizing radiation to heat and cook food. The microwave’s magnetron produces electromagnetic waves, which penetrate the food and cause the water molecules to vibrate, producing heat. However, if the microwave’s internal temperature exceeds its safe operating range, the magnetron can become damaged, leading to overheating. Regular maintenance, including cleaning and checking for blockages, can help prevent microwave overheating.
Safety Precautions and Tips
Preventing microwave overheating requires a combination of proper use and maintenance. One of the most important safety precautions is to never leave a microwave unattended while it’s in use. This can help prevent overheating and reduce the risk of accidents. Additionally, it’s essential to follow the manufacturer’s instructions for cooking times and power levels.
Another important safety tip is to regularly clean the microwave and check for blockages. Food residue and splatters can accumulate in the microwave and cause overheating. Cleaning the microwave regularly can help prevent this. It’s also essential to check the microwave’s ventilation system for blockages, as these can prevent the appliance from cooling properly. By taking these simple precautions, you can help prevent microwave overheating and ensure your safety.
Built-in Safety Features
Some microwaves come with built-in safety features, such as automatic shut-off and child safety locks, to prevent overheating and accidents. Automatic shut-off, for example, can turn off the microwave if it detects an anomaly in the cooking process, such as overheating. Child safety locks, on the other hand, can prevent children from accidentally starting the microwave or changing the cooking settings.
These safety features can provide an added layer of protection against microwave overheating and accidents. However, it’s essential to remember that safety features are not a substitute for proper use and maintenance. Regular cleaning and maintenance, as well as following the manufacturer’s instructions, are still essential for preventing microwave overheating.
External Factors and Overheating
External factors, such as high temperatures and humidity, can affect a microwave’s tendency to overheat. For example, if the microwave is placed in a hot and humid environment, it may be more prone to overheating. This is because the microwave’s cooling system may struggle to keep up with the external temperature, leading to overheating.
To mitigate the effects of external factors, it’s essential to place the microwave in a well-ventilated area, away from direct sunlight and heat sources. Additionally, regular maintenance, including cleaning and checking for blockages, can help prevent microwave overheating. By taking these precautions, you can help reduce the risk of overheating and ensure your microwave runs safely and efficiently.
What to Do in Case of Overheating
If your microwave overheats, it’s essential to take immediate action. First, turn off the power to the microwave and unplug it from the wall outlet. This can help prevent further damage and reduce the risk of accidents. Next, ventilate the area to remove any burning smells or smoke.
If you notice any damage to the microwave, such as burn marks or melted plastic, it’s essential to have it inspected and repaired by a qualified technician. In some cases, the microwave may need to be replaced. By taking immediate action and seeking professional help, you can help prevent further damage and ensure your safety.

Can I use metal utensils in my microwave?
No, it’s not recommended to use metal utensils in your microwave. Metal utensils can cause sparks and lead to overheating or even fires. It’s essential to use microwave-safe utensils, such as glass or plastic, to prevent accidents.
How can I prevent food from splattering in my microwave?
To prevent food from splattering in your microwave, it’s essential to cover the food with a microwave-safe lid or plastic wrap. This can help contain the food and prevent splatters. Additionally, using a lower power level and cooking time can also help reduce splattering.
